Transaction 59883ac3fc8bf73ac5c4db51d54e10b24d5ba4010729f77e6263a7e0cf3de390
1 Input
1 Output
-
59883ac3fc8bf73ac5c4db51d54e10b24d5ba4010729f77e6263a7e0cf3de390:0
- value
- 200000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 456efc72eeb6944027bad65012c159325181dffe OP_EQUALVERIFY OP_CHECKSIG
- address
- 17L8agtUFLgavN98bgDLu9EVfciaCrnvCA